Deborah Klein
Out of the Past 1995-2007
5 April - 18 May 2008
This survey exhibition focuses on the evolution of Klein's
artistic practice through selected key works which represent
her major thematic concerns and preoccupation with feminine identity
and creative history. They include early Film Noir linocuts;
Tattooed Faces and Figures exploring women's sewing iconography;
elaborate braided hair and portrait miniatures incorporating
lace; large scale meticulous 'rear view' paintings; drawings,
combining decorative combs and voluminous hair; and the recent
monumental moth mask drawings.
